maik Δημοσιεύτηκε January 31, 2014 at 10:17 πμ Δημοσιεύτηκε January 31, 2014 at 10:17 πμ του εκανα μια τροποποιηση για να γράφει και τον α/α . Δεν με αφηνει να το ανεβάσω σαν αρχείο . Μπορειτε να το αντιγράψετε με τον Notepad σε αρχείο με ονομα PO2TXT.LSP ;| Save the co-ordinates of POINT entities in text file [email protected] December 2003;_____________________________________|;; | Revision to write a/a before xi yi zi [email protected] January 2014; ====================================|;(defun c:PO2TXT (/ file points c i) ;POints to TeXT (setq file (open (getfiled "specify output file" "c:/" "TXT" 1) "w")) (setq points (ssget) i 0) (repeat (sslength points) (if (= "POINT" (cdr (assoc 0 (entget (ssname points i))))) (setq c (cdr (assoc 10 (entget (ssname points i)))) i (1+ i) ) ) (write-line (strcat (itoa i) " " (rtos (car c) 2 2 ) " " (rtos (cadr c) 2 2 ) " " (rtos (caddr c) 2 2 ) ) file) ) (close file) (Princ)) 2
terry Δημοσιεύτηκε January 31, 2014 at 11:49 πμ Δημοσιεύτηκε January 31, 2014 at 11:49 πμ Σας ευχαριστω. Θα τα δοκιμασω αργοτερα!
lou Δημοσιεύτηκε January 31, 2014 at 07:46 μμ Δημοσιεύτηκε January 31, 2014 at 07:46 μμ Φίλε maik μπορείς να ξαναγράψεις τον κώδικα αλλά να δίνει 4 δεκαδικά στις συντ/νες και όχι μόνο 2? (να το έχουμε το αρχειάκι σε όλες τις βερσιόν ..... )
maik Δημοσιεύτηκε February 1, 2014 at 09:46 πμ Δημοσιεύτηκε February 1, 2014 at 09:46 πμ Τώρα μπορείς να επιλέγεις με την εντολή UNITS πόσα δεκαδικά θέλεις . ;| Save the co-ordinates of POINT entities in text file [email protected] December 2003;_____________________________________|;; | Revision to write a/a before xi yi zi [email protected] January 2014; ====================================|;(defun c:PO2TXT (/ file points c i) ;POints to TeXT (setq file (open (getfiled "specify output file" "c:/" "TXT" 1) "w")) (setq points (ssget) i 0) (repeat (sslength points) (if (= "POINT" (cdr (assoc 0 (entget (ssname points i))))) (setq c (cdr (assoc 10 (entget (ssname points i)))) i (1+ i) ) ) (write-line (strcat (itoa i) " " (rtos (car c) 2 ) " " (rtos (cadr c) 2 ) " " (rtos (caddr c) 2 ) ) file) ) (close file) (Princ)) 3
lou Δημοσιεύτηκε February 1, 2014 at 05:46 μμ Δημοσιεύτηκε February 1, 2014 at 05:46 μμ Maik είσαι ωραίος...ευχαριστώ! +1 απο μένα.
Antiermitianos Δημοσιεύτηκε July 24, 2015 at 01:45 μμ Δημοσιεύτηκε July 24, 2015 at 01:45 μμ (edited) Καλησπέρα Συνάδελφοι, Αν δε δουλέψει, κάτι παίζει με το style γραφής σου, υποθέτω ότι δεν έχεις το αρχειάκι wgsimpl.shx που είναι απαραίτητο, είναι μέσα στο zip αρχείο που περιείχε και το korkth.lsp... γνωρίζει κανείς πού μπορώ να βρω αυτό το font ;; Έχω ψάξει, αλλά μάταια...Εάν κάποιος το έχει ας κάνει τον κόπο να μου το στείλει. Βρίσκεται στο path C:\Program Files\Autodesk\AutoCAD 20??\Fonts Είναι δυνατό με αυτό το Font σε single line text να γράψουμε το "εις τον κύβον" πληκτρολογώντας \U+00B3 (με Num Lock On) ; To "εις το τετράγωνον" με \U+00B2 το έκανε απ' ότι θυμάμαι... Edited July 24, 2015 at 01:46 μμ by Antiermitianos
Elounda Δημοσιεύτηκε September 18, 2017 at 05:42 πμ Δημοσιεύτηκε September 18, 2017 at 05:42 πμ (edited) Καλημέρα.Υπάρχει lisp το οποίο να αριθμεί τα points(σημεία) και να ταυτόχρονα να βγάζει το μήκος μεταξύ point to point (πχ σε μια polyline) σε acad κατευθείαν.Εχω κατεβάσει κάποια αλλά το εξάγει σε note Το site έχει προβλέψει ακόμα μια φορά ! http://www.michanikos.gr/files/file/644-toposyntlsp-%CE%A0%CE%AF%CE%BD%CE%B1%CE%BA%CE%B1%CF%82-%CE%A3%CF%85%CE%BD%CF%84%CE%B5%CF%84%CE%B1%CE%B3%CE%BC%CE%AD%CE%BD%CF%89%CE%BD-%CE%B3%CE%B9%CE%B1-%CE%94%CE%B9%CE%B1%CE%B3%CF%81%CE%AC%CE%BC%CE%BC%CE%B1%CF%84%CE%B1-%CE%94%CF%8C%CE%BC%CE%B7/ το λίνκ οποιος αλλος ενδιαφέρεται Edited September 18, 2017 at 08:07 πμ by Elounda
eikonikos Δημοσιεύτηκε June 1, 2019 at 04:12 μμ Δημοσιεύτηκε June 1, 2019 at 04:12 μμ (edited) (μεταφέρθηκε στο παρόν θέμα. Pavlos33) Καλησπέρα σας, ανοίγω το θέμα για AutoLISP 1η Ερώτηση. Ενδιαφέρομαι να βρω σημειώσεις AutoLISP. Μπορείτε να προτείνετε κάποια Link? 2η Ερωτηση. Αν κάποιος είναι μηχανικός τι μπορεί να πετύχει με την AutoLISP? Edited June 1, 2019 at 05:07 μμ by Pavlos33
maik Δημοσιεύτηκε June 2, 2019 at 12:04 μμ Δημοσιεύτηκε June 2, 2019 at 12:04 μμ 19 ώρες πριν, eikonikos said: (μεταφέρθηκε στο παρόν θέμα. Pavlos33) Καλησπέρα σας, ανοίγω το θέμα για AutoLISP 1η Ερώτηση. Ενδιαφέρομαι να βρω σημειώσεις AutoLISP. Μπορείτε να προτείνετε κάποια Link? 2η Ερωτηση. Αν κάποιος είναι μηχανικός τι μπορεί να πετύχει με την AutoLISP? 1η Ερώτηση : https://studfiles.net/preview/955467/ Ειναι η αγγλική έκδοση του βιβλίου του George Omura . Εχει εκδοθεί και στα Ελληνικά . Επίσης μπορίες googlάροντας να βρείς πολλά sites με σημειώσεις , manual κ. λπ. 2η Ερώτηση : Μπορείς να κάνεις οτι και με οποιαδήποτε αλλη γλώσσα . Δηλαδή να κάνεις πρόγραμμα για κάθε σειρά επαναλαμβανομένων κινήσεων , ώστε να τις εκτελεί αυτόματα ο υπολογιστής αντι για εσένα . Αυτό ουσιαστικά ειναι που θέλουμε απο κάθε πρόγραμμα. Αν εχεις συγκεκριμένες διαδικασίες που εκτελείς τακτικά γράψε και βλέπουμε . . . 1
Directionless Δημοσιεύτηκε June 21, 2019 at 06:35 μμ Δημοσιεύτηκε June 21, 2019 at 06:35 μμ Γνωρίζει κανείς που θα μπορούσα να βρω lisp να διαβάζει με τη σειρά (κλικάροντας) κλειστές polylines και εν συνεχεία να τις εξάγει είτε σε table εντός του σχεδιαστικού είτε σε .csv ;
Recommended Posts
Δημιουργήστε ένα λογαριασμό ή συνδεθείτε προκειμένου να αφήσετε κάποιο σχόλιο
Πρέπει να είστε μέλος για να μπορέσετε να αφήσετε κάποιο σχόλιο
Δημιουργία λογαριασμού
Κάντε μια δωρεάν εγγραφή στην κοινότητά μας. Είναι εύκολο!
Εγγραφή νέου λογαριασμούΣύνδεση
Εάν έ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.
Συνδεθείτε τώρα